Sign In — Free (10 views/day)Habonim Labor Zionist Youth Inc, founded in 1935, is a small nonprofit that reported $667K in total revenue in fiscal year 2024. Revenue fell 42% from the prior year — a significant decline worth monitoring.
To build a personal bond and commitment between North american Jewish youth and Israel, and to create Jewish leaders who will actualize the principles of social justice, equality, peace and coexistence in Israel and North America

Program: Training and Seminars: Increase the education and enrichment of Jewish youth through various projects, including but not lmited to a six day reunion seminar, year-round educational and social activities and assistance to the six affiliated Zionist summer camps in North America

Program: Workshop. A seven to nine month gap year (between high school and college) program in Israel where participants will live collectively in small groups with peers from the international Habonim Dror community. Additionally, the participants will travel in Israel while learning about the diverse history of Israel, the Israeli people and the Hebrew language

Program: Machaneh Bonim B'Israel (MBI) Five to seven week summer program in Israel which creates young leaders with a strong Jewish identity through first-hand experience and with the people, their history, culture and society.
